The Ghana Commission for UNESCO is pleased to inform you that UNESCO has launched the 17th Call for Applications to the International Fund for Cultural Diversity (IFCD) established under the 2005 Convention on the Protection and Promotion of the Diversity of Cultural Expressions.

The IFCD is a voluntary multi-donor fund which supports the emergence of dynamic cultural sectors in developing countries. Through an open and competitive process, projects will be selected based on their ability to generate concrete and lasting results towards the development of the creative sectors in developing countries that are Parties to the 2005 Convention.

Image credit: Visual Arts students from Senior High Schools across Kumasi

The projects must clearly lead to structural changes through:
1. Implementation and/or elaboration of policies and measures that have a direct,  structural impact on the creation, production, distribution and access to a diversity of cultural goods and services.
2. The strengthening of capacities in public institutions and civil society organizations to support viable local and regional cultural industries and markets.

Since 2010, the IFCD has invested more than US$ 13.6 million through 175 projects in 77 developing countries. These diverse initiatives have contributed to the developing and implementing of cultural policies, strengthening of cultural entrepreneurship, facilitating access to new markets for cultural goods and services, and reinforcing the participation and inclusion of populations in cultural life.

Public institutions, and non-governmental organizations (NGO) from eligible countries are invited to submit their proposals, as well as international NGOs registered in countries that are Parties to the 2005 Convention.

The 17th Call for Applications will close on 6 May 2026, noon Paris time.
